What Does a Florida Business Broker and M&A Advisor Actually Do?
First things first: what’s the difference between a business broker and an M&A advisor?
A business broker typically helps small to mid-sized businesses ("main street") find buyers, manage the transaction, and close deals under $5M.
An M&A advisor works with lower middle-market businesses—typically $5M to $50M in revenue—focusing on strategy, valuation, negotiation, and often bringing in private equity or strategic buyers.

What Does a Florida Business Broker Actually Do?
A Florida business broker serves as your advocate, negotiator, strategist, and deal closer. They're not just a middleman—they're a business matchmaker, guiding you through every phase of the sale:
Valuation: Determining what your business is really worth based on SDE, EBITDA, industry comps, and buyer demand.
Preparation: Helping you organize financials, normalize earnings (add-backs), and prepare a clean, compelling package.
Marketing: Confidentially marketing your business to qualified buyers across private equity, strategic, and individual pools.
Negotiation: Protecting your interest while negotiating price, terms, and post-sale conditions.
Due Diligence & Closing: Managing document flow, buyer requests, deal timelines, and legal checkpoints until funds hit your account.
A good Florida business broker removes friction, uncertainty, and wasted time from the process.

How Much Is Your Florida Business Worth?
The biggest myth in the market? That businesses are worth "3x revenue" or some other arbitrary rule of thumb.
In reality, buyers look at:
Seller’s Discretionary Earnings (SDE)
Recurring vs. one-time revenue
Owner dependency
Systems and team in place
Growth potential
Industry risk profile

The Step-by-Step Process of Selling a Business in Florida
Here’s what selling your business really looks like when you work with a trusted Florida business broker like Sailfish:
1. Confidential Consultation
We start with a low-pressure, confidential call to understand your goals, timeline, and concerns.
2. Valuation & Exit Strategy
We review your financials and provide a custom valuation range. We also advise you on what improvements (if any) could increase your sale price.
3. Packaging & Prep
We craft a confidential information memorandum (CIM), identify add-backs, and clean up red flags.
4. Buyer Outreach
Using our private network of vetted buyers, we market your business confidentially—without listing sites that leak your identity.
5. Qualifying Buyers
We filter tire-kickers, push for proof of funds or lender pre-approvals, and only bring you serious buyers.
6. Negotiation & Offers
We present offers, explain terms, and lead negotiations to protect your valuation and future.
7. Due Diligence & Closing
We quarterback the legal, financial, and logistical steps to get the deal across the finish line.
8. Transition Support
We help structure post-sale transition periods, employment agreements (if needed), and ensure your legacy and team are protected.

FAQ: Selling a Business in Florida
Q: Do I need perfect books to sell my Florida business?
A: No. Most small business owners have imperfect financials. A skilled broker will clean up the numbers, create add-back schedules, and present your true earnings clearly to buyers.
Q: How long does it take to sell a business in Florida?
A: It depends on the business, but 6–12 months is typical. With strong buyer demand and good preparation, we often close within 90–120 days.
Q: What industries are selling well right now?
A: Home services, HVAC, construction, digital marketing, professional services, and niche manufacturing are all in high demand across Florida.
Q: Can I stay involved after the sale?
A: Absolutely. Some sellers stay on as consultants or employees to help with transition—and some buyers require it for SBA financing. We help you navigate what works best for your lifestyle.
Q: What is my Florida business actually worth?
A: That depends on your SDE, growth, team, and industry. Most small businesses sell for 2.5x–4.5x SDE, but multiples can go higher with recurring revenue, scale, and clean operations.
Q: What if I’m not ready yet?
A: Then we start planning. Even if your exit is 1–3 years out, a great broker will help you increase value in the meantime.
